Deploying more than one web application on a single server used to require a lot of infrastructure fiddling. Docker made this better, but some things that are new in Kamal 2 make deploying containerized applications even easier. Kamal is a deployment tool from Basecamp that leans on Docker and its own integrated proxy to simplify deploying web apps. Kamal 2 makes deploying more than one Rails app to the same server easier.
